The most unstable software product ever.,
This review is from: Hallmark Card Studio Deluxe 2007 [Old Version] (CD-ROM)
The card choices are large and the feature set of the program is great...
-but- We keep upgrading to new versions of the card software to get new cards and in the apparently vain hope that the developers of the software will someday get their act together. To say that this software is unstable is the understatement of the year. On average, one out of three cards causes the software to crash, usually after it has printed page one (outside) and before printing page two (inside). No problem you think? Well not really. If you print page one of the card and it crashes, of course you lose all of the personalizations but if you restart the program and redo the personalizations you have to print out a whole new card because the program won't let you only print out the inside of the card onto the already printed outside. Sure, the dialog box has a drop down that says "Page 2 of 2" giving you the "impression" that you should be able to do this but even with this option selected, it proceeds to print out the card, the whole card, yet again. Needless to say this results in a lot of card stock wastage and card stock is expensive. We have a Dell Dimension with a huge hard drive, 2.6 GHz hyperthreaded P4, 1GB of memory, and are running Home XP with SP2, with a HP color laserjet printer on an Ethernet so I really don't think that the problem is that we don't have "enough computer"... This is simply the most unstable software we have ever used, and has been so for three product updates. (Why did we buy the latest one? Well, it turns out that old versions of the card software seem to "go bad" all by themselves with card choices simply disappearing, and so the software forces you to either stop using it or upgrade.) Go buy a set of markers instead, it will be far less frustrating. The Sierra Home developers should be embarrassed that they put out such an amazingly poorly designed product. Hallmark needs to get a new software developer...

Doesn't print properly,
By tnmats (Raleigh/Durham area, NC) - See all my reviews
This review is from: Hallmark Card Studio Deluxe 2007 [Old Version] (CD-ROM)
There's a fundamental flaw in the software: it won't print a greeting card properly unless you have a borderless-capable printer. If you print on a printer that can't do borderless printing, the front cover image on the card will be off center. Check the FAQ section of the hallmarksoftware web site and they even admit as much.
It's a known bug, and a 'fix' has been promised since December according to the hallmarksoftware on-line forums. Until the fix is released, if ever, avoid this program. UPDATE: The software developer finally released a patch for the above problem in May. It seems to fix the printing issues (finally).

Disappointing,
This review is from: Hallmark Card Studio Deluxe 2007 [Old Version] (CD-ROM)
After being "guaranteed" by one of Hallmark's customer service reps that this version was much improved over the past few versions, I was once again disappointed that you could not open more than one project at a time (Hallmark rep said you could) or easily flip between two projects (not even a card and coordinating envelope!). Graphics STILL cannot be selected in multiples (the Hallmark rep said you would be able to). You must select one graphic, paste it to your project, go back and select the second graphic, paste it, etc. Graphics cannot be edited either (again the Hallmark rep said they could be)--not even to crop out a small portion. The rep said they now had a photo editor that can be used on graphics--not true! It can only be used on photos, not graphics and it, too, has limitations compared with photo editors included with their competitors (PrintShop, CreataCard, Print Master). There are many limitations in working with text boxes as well. If you want a line of text to have one word in one color and another word in different color or font, each word has to be in a separate text box (this is not true with the competitors named above). I do wonder if they actually let comsumers beta test any of their new products before releasing them--Hallmark has to have heard about all these drawbacks to their program, yet never change them. I agree with the other reviewer in that that are many duplicate cards from previous versions. I am also disappointed that many of the graphics included in their clip art are still rather low-end (and not much different from last year's version). The graphics on their pre-made cards are, for the most part, of excellent quality--much different from the clip art. I wouldn't waste my money on this version if you already own versions from any of the past several years. And I definitely wouldn't expect anything in the area of customer service from Hallmark since their reps obviously do not use the product!
